Abstract
The invention belongs to the technical field of hollow glass windows, and particularly relates to an improvement on a hollow glass structure with a built-in pleated curtain. The hollow glass comprises a hollow glass window, a pleated curtain and a controller, wherein one side of the pleated curtain is fixed on the inner side of a side frame of the hollow glass window, and the other side of the pleated curtain is connected with a sliding beam; the sliding beam is of a hollow structure; the manipulator is divided into an inner manipulator and an outer manipulator, wherein the inner manipulator is arranged in a side frame of the hollow glass window and further comprises a closing pull rope, an opening pull rope, a first pulley assembly, a second pulley assembly, a third pulley assembly and a fourth pulley assembly. On the existing hollow glass window structure, the structure of the pull rope matched with the pulley block is used for transversely opening and closing the pleated curtain, the opening and closing structure is simple and reliable, the production cost is low, and the noise generated by opening and closing is small.

Background
The shutter is characterized in that a hollow layer is arranged between the two layers of glass, so that the temperature and noise inside and outside a room can be effectively isolated, a shutter system is designed between the two layers of glass, and the permeability and lighting of the window can be adjusted as required. The built-in blind curtain of double-deck cavity glass can also provide better sound insulation and heat preservation effect, reduces the transmission of indoor outer temperature and the invasion of ambient noise, and secondly, the transmissivity of window can be adjusted to the blind curtain, realizes nimble sight control and privacy protection.
However, in practical applications, there are two main problems presented by customers: firstly, gaps inevitably exist between adjacent blades, so that the outdoor peeping indoor space can be realized, the privacy protection effect is poor, and the indoor space cannot be applied to places with higher shading requirements. Secondly, the blind is opened and closed in a lifting manner, so that the requirement that a user views a local landscape by using a window can not be met, and the user can be shielded. For this reason, there is a need for a lateral telescopic sunshade for the relevant customers.
Prior art built-in telescopic monoblock sun shades, such as bulletin nos.: CN 218912760U, name: the patent technology of the arc hollow built-in honeycomb curtain glass has the following technical problems: the telescopic structure has the advantages of complex design, high installation difficulty, high cost, poor reliability and high running noise.

Example 1
In fig. 1 to 8, a hollow glass of a transversely opened/closed built-in pleated curtain is shown, which comprises a pleated curtain 1 and a controller 6, wherein the controller 6 is divided into an inner controller 61 and an outer controller 62, the inner controller 61 is arranged in a side frame of the hollow glass window 2, the hollow glass window 2 comprises an upper frame 21 and a lower frame 22, a left side frame 23, a right side frame 24, an upper left corner 25, a lower left corner 26, an upper right corner 27, a lower right corner 28, an outer glass 29a and an inner glass 29b, the upper left corner 25 is respectively inserted with the left end and the upper end of the upper frame 21, the upper left side frame 23, the lower left corner 26 is respectively inserted with the left end and the lower end of the lower frame 22, the upper left side frame 23 is respectively inserted with the right end of the upper frame 21, the upper end of the right side corner frame 24, the lower right corner 28 is respectively inserted with the right end of the lower frame 22, the outer glass 29a is respectively inserted with the right end of the upper frame 21, the lower frame 22, the left side frame 23 and the right side frame 24 are respectively adhered on one side, the inner glass 29b is kept in a separate cavity state with the outer glass 29a and the inner glass 29b is arranged in a cavity between the upper frame and the left side frame and the inner glass window, and the inner glass window is formed in a cavity, and the inner glass cavity is arranged between the left side and the inner glass and the left side frames 29b and the inner glass window. In this embodiment, four frames of the hollow glass window 1 adopt a structure that a frame body is covered with a plate for buckling, so that the stay cord is convenient to install and maintain in a later period, which is a conventional technology in the field, and detailed description is omitted.
In this embodiment, the inner manipulator 61 and the outer manipulator 62 adopt magnetic attraction control, which is a conventional control structure in the field, and is not described in detail, and the present embodiment further includes a manual transverse opening and closing device, specifically: a closing rope 4, an opening rope 5, a first pulley assembly 7, a second pulley assembly 8, a third pulley assembly 9 and a fourth pulley assembly 10.
Referring to fig. 1, 7 and 8, in this embodiment, one side of the pleated curtain 1 is fixed on the inner side of the left side frame 23 of the hollow glass window 2, the other side is connected with the sliding beam 3, the upper and lower sides of the sliding beam 3 are respectively provided with a sliding block 31, two sides of the sliding block 31 are provided with sliding grooves 311, two sides of the frame strips of the upper and lower frames of the hollow glass window 2 are respectively provided with an extension edge 214, one side extension edge of the upper and lower frames is provided with a sliding strip 211 matched with the sliding grooves 311, the sliding grooves 311 of the upper and lower sliding blocks are slidably embedded with the same sliding strip 211, so that the pleated curtain 1 can slide in the hollow glass window 2, meanwhile, the sliding strips 211 and the frame strips 213 of the upper and lower frames form a wire slot 212 (namely a gap between the sliding grooves 311 and the sliding strips 211) for wiring, and through holes communicated with the inner cavity of the sliding beam 3 are correspondingly arranged on the sliding block 31.
In this embodiment, the first pulley assembly 7, the second pulley assembly 8, the third pulley assembly 9 and the fourth pulley assembly 10 have the same structure, and all adopt the structure that four pulleys 73 are arranged on the pulley bracket 72, wherein the pulley bracket 72 is connected with the corner 71 of the hollow glass window 2 by adopting a buckling structure or is integrally formed, the pulleys 73 are arranged on the pulley bracket 72 by bearings, so that the running resistance can be effectively reduced, and the purchasing cost of parts can be reduced by adopting a uniform structure.
In this embodiment, the first pulley assembly 7 is disposed at a corner above the inner manipulator 61, the second pulley assembly 8 is disposed at a corner below the inner manipulator 61, the third pulley assembly 9 is disposed at a corner on the other side of the first pulley assembly 7 on the same horizontal plane, and the fourth pulley assembly 10 is disposed at a corner on the other side of the second pulley assembly 8 on the same horizontal plane.
The inner manipulator 61 is provided with a turning wheel 611 at the upper and lower part.
Referring to fig. 3, one end of the closing rope 4 is fixed on the pulley bracket of the second pulley assembly 8, and after upward bypassing the lower side crank wheel of the inner manipulator 61, downward bypassing the left side pulley on the second pulley assembly 8, then leftward passing through the slot of the lower frame 22, upward passing through the through hole on the sliding block 31, then passing through the sliding beam 3, extending from the top end of the sliding beam 3, rightward bypassing the pulley on the first pulley assembly 7 through the slot of the upper frame 21, downward bypassing the right side pulley on the second pulley assembly 8, upward bypassing the lower crank wheel of the inner manipulator 61, and finally being fixed on the pulley bracket of the second pulley assembly 8, in this embodiment, both ends of the closing rope 4 are fixed at the same place on the pulley bracket.
Referring to fig. 4, one end of the opening rope 5 is fixed on a pulley bracket 72 of the first pulley assembly 7, bypasses the upper side turning pulley of the inner manipulator 61 downwards, bypasses the pulleys on the first pulley assembly 7 upwards (in turn: left lower pulley, left upper pulley and right upper pulley), bypasses the pulleys on the third pulley assembly 9 leftwards via the inner cavity of the upper frame 21 (left upper pulley and left lower pulley), bypasses the pulleys on the fourth pulley assembly 10 downwards (left upper pulley and right upper pulley), bypasses the wire chase of the lower frame 22 rightwards, passes through the through hole of the sliding block 31 upwards, passes through the sliding beam 3, stretches out the upper end of the sliding beam 3, bypasses the right upper pulley of the third pulley block 9 leftwards via the wire chase of the upper frame 21, bypasses the three pulleys on the first pulley assembly 7 rightwards via the inner cavity of the upper frame 21 (in turn: left upper pulley, right upper pulley and right lower pulley), bypasses the upper side pulley of the inner manipulator 61 downwards, and is finally fixed on the pulley bracket of the first pulley assembly 7. In this embodiment, both ends of the opening rope 5 are fixed in one place.
The wiring patterns of the closing rope 4 and the opening rope 5 can ensure the synchronism of the movement of the upper and lower ends of the sliding beam 31 when the closing and opening operations are performed.
The crank wheel 611 on the inner manipulator 61 is essentially a movable pulley, which serves to amplify the travel of the inner manipulator 61, i.e. the distance the inner manipulator 61 moves: the sliding beam 3 moves by a distance=1:2, ensuring that the inner manipulator 61 can fully close or open the pleated cover 1 in the stroke.
The use method is that referring to fig. 3, the outer controller 62 is pulled upwards to close the pleated curtain 1, the outer controller 62 drives the inner controller 61 to move upwards, at the moment, the closing pull ropes 4 on the upper side and the lower side of the pleated curtain move rightwards, and the sliding beam 3 is pulled to move rightwards transversely, so that the pleated curtain 1 is driven to be closed.
Referring to fig. 4, to open the pleated curtain 1, the outer manipulator 62 is pulled downward, the outer manipulator 62 drives the inner manipulator 61 to move downward, at this time, the opening ropes 5 on the upper and lower sides of the pleated curtain move leftward, and the sliding beam 3 is pulled to move laterally leftward, so as to drive the pleated curtain 1 to open.
It should be noted that, those skilled in the art can also obtain the inspired by this, the assembly direction of the pleated cover 1 and the two pull ropes can be changed, and then the controller 6 is turned to be opened upwards and closed downwards.
In this embodiment, a bearing 312 is disposed in the through hole of the slider 31, and the slider 31 passes through windows formed on two sides of the sliding slot 311, so that the bearing 312 protrudes out of the inner wall of the sliding slot 311 on the side surface of the slider, and the bearing 312 is tightly attached to the sliding strip 211. The contact surface between the sliding block 31 and the sliding strip 211 is reduced, and sliding friction between the sliding block and the sliding strip ensures smooth opening and closing of the pleated curtain 1, and further reduces noise during opening and closing.
The corner parts of the bearing 311, which are contacted with the opening pull rope 5 and the closing pull rope 4, are arc-shaped, so that the pull rope can be effectively prevented from being worn.
Referring to fig. 6, in this embodiment, two avoidance rings 612 are disposed on the left side of the inner manipulator 61, and the closing rope 4 passes through the avoidance rings 612, so as to prevent the inner manipulator 61 from interfering with the operation of the closing rope 4.
In this embodiment, the present invention further includes a plurality of relay rollers 11, where the relay rollers are disposed in the upper frame 21 of the hollow glass window, so as to avoid friction and wear between the opening rope 5 and the inner wall of the upper frame 21.
Example 2
Referring to fig. 9, compared with embodiment 1, in this embodiment, the left and right sides of the slider 31 are provided with avoiding pulleys 313, and the lower end surface of the avoiding pulley 312 protrudes from the end surface of the slider 31, so that friction between the pull rope and the end surface of the slider 31 can be prevented.
Example 3
Referring to fig. 10, compared with embodiment 1, in this embodiment, the sliding strips 211 matched with the sliding grooves 311 are disposed on the extending edges 214 on both sides of the upper frame 21, and the same structure is also adopted in the lower frame 22, and the sliding grooves 311 on both sides of the upper and lower sliding blocks are slidably engaged with the sliding strips 211, so that the sliding blocks 31 can be more stably operated on the sliding strips 211.
Example 4
Referring to fig. 11, compared with embodiments 1,2, and 3, in this embodiment, the manually opened pleated curtain structure is applied to the arc-shaped hollow glass window 12, and a plurality of supporting rollers are required to be disposed in the wire grooves 212 of the upper and lower frames in the arc-shaped hollow glass window 12 to prevent the pull rope from rubbing against the inner walls of the frames.
